- In this video guitar lesson, I show you how to play "That's Alright (Mama)" by Elvis Presley. In the video, I show you how to play the chords, strumming, licks, "tabs" and anything else that you will need to play this great song.

Elvis was VERY influenced by Western Swing at this time in his life. He then put the blues back into the songs that used the songs but not the blues in them. But on this first record, it's just bright and happy, but not ever twangy. Scotty took care of that.
